Department of Fire Deferral by Remco
- (way too) EASY start immediately when the game launches (it will take a long while before the fires start)
- NORMAL? wait 90 seconds before moving in game
- CHALLENGE wait 2.5 minutes before moving in game
Run around trying to prevent burn-downs. Which will get harder and harder. Controls WASD or arrow keys (tank controls).
Don't like this map? Press refresh! Procedural generation :-)
(Only) When moving, water spews forth from your fire-engine. There are power-ups to (temporarily) widen the angle or lengthen the reach. (Those won't respawn.)
You lose when the burn percentage is > 50% Try to get the best time.
Space-bar toggles an accessibility-mode.
- Burns: Grass, Wall, Bridge (will fall into water)
- Won't burn: Water, Road (it will look worse though), (Complete) Rubble (is already burned).
- Drive: Grass, Road, Bridge, Rubble
- Can't drive through: Wall, Water
